WebBeginning in 1898 and continuing to some degree until 1902, a smallpox epidemic spread across the United States. St. Paul and the surrounding area did not escape this outbreak. Ten years earlier, when there was no rail service in the region, a smallpox epidemic probably would not have occurred. WebIn 1902, faced with an outbreak of smallpox, the Board of Health of the city of Cambridge, Massachusetts adopted a regulation ordering the vaccination or revaccination of all its inhabitants. [2] Cambridge pastor Henning Jacobson had lived through an era of mandatory vaccinations back in his original home of Sweden. [3]
